IBM Support

PI06810: MSGDFR3503E WRITE ERROR RECEIVED RUNNING DEDB FAST RECOVERY

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• The following error message was received running a DFR job:
    DFR3503E (024) AREA=areaname DD=ddname, WRITE ERROR,
       CI-NO=nnnnnnnn - ADS STOPPED
    The error occurred when DFR set the dummy default segments for
    the pre-allocation CI's.  When interpreting the last CI, there
    was a logic error in the code.  This error caused DFR to
    incorrectly set the dummy default segment to the CI that is
    out of the AREA. An I/O error occurs while writing the CI
    and DFR issued the error message and canceled the recovery
    of the AREA.
    
    This is a retro-fit of APAR PI04824 for a IMS V11 or V12
    environment.
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All IMS DEDB FAST RECOVERY Version 2         *
    *                 Release 2 (FMID=H1J2220) users who use the   *
    *                 DEDB SDEP segment in IMS V11 or V12.         *
    ****************************************************************
    * PROBLEM DESCRIPTION: If new pre-allocation CI of SDEP wraps  *
    *                      an area end before IMS failure, DFR     *
    *                      issues a MSGDFR3503E message by an I/O  *
    *                      error of the CI and cancels the         *
    *                      recovery of the AREA.                   *
    ****************************************************************
    * RECOMMENDATION: Apply the maintenance for this APAR.         *
    ****************************************************************
    When DFR sets the dummy default segments for the pre-allocation
    CIs, DFR uses a HI-A-RBA instead of a start RBA of the last CI,
    in order to interpret the last CI.
    Therefore DFR incorrectly sets the dummy default segment to the
    CI that is out of the area.
    

Problem conclusion

  • The following modules have been modified.
    (x = B or C)
    *
    DFRL595x - This module was changed so that it may wrap an area
               end when an start RBA of a next CI is the same as a
               value of a DMACBRBA field.
    *
    DFRNRDOx - This module was changed so that a value may be set
               into DBLKFSOF (OFFSET TO FIRST FSE) field.
    *
    

Temporary fix

Comments

APAR Information

  • APAR number

    PI06810

  • Reported component name

    DEDB FAST RECOV

  • Reported component ID

    5655E3200

  • Reported release

    220

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2013-11-22

  • Closed date

    2013-11-26

  • Last modified date

    2013-11-26

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    UI12951

Modules/Macros

  •    DFRL595B DFRL595C DFRNRDOB DFRNRDOC
    

Fix information

  • Fixed component name

    DEDB FAST RECOV

  • Fixed component ID

    5655E3200

Applicable component levels

[{"Line of Business":{"code":null,"label":null},"Business Unit":{"code":"BU048","label":"IBM Software"},"Product":{"code":"SSCX895","label":"IMS DEDB Fast Recovery"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"2.2.0"}]

Document Information

Modified date:
03 October 2020